Information assurance security officer vs information assurance engineer

The differences between information assurance security officers and information assurance engineers can be seen in a few details. Each job has different responsibilities and duties. It typically takes 4-6 years to become both an information assurance security officer and an information assurance engineer. Additionally, an information assurance engineer has an average salary of $89,291, which is higher than the $68,602 average annual salary of an information assurance security officer.

The top three skills for an information assurance security officer include security procedures, DOD and ACAS. The most important skills for an information assurance engineer are RMF, DOD, and IAM.

Differences between information assurance security officer and information assurance engineer duties and responsibilities

Information assurance security officer example responsibilities.

  • Implement a manage endpoint encryption solution utilizing TrendMicro MobileArmor to secure university workstations against sensitive data loss.
  • Maintain HBSS systems and ACAS on SIPRNET and NIPRNET networks.
  • Utilize Nessus/SCAP scans in conjunction with STiG documentation to adhere with DISA compliance for system submission for ATO.
  • Facilitate systems security configuration baselines for servers and workstations using DOD standards and best practices.
  • Generate ATO, ATT, and AFU packages.
  • Install and update scanning boxes with ACAS and REDHAT for system compliance.

Information assurance engineer example responsibilities.

  • Install, configure, and managing ACAS deployments to assess the current vulnerabilities and security posture for classify networks.
  • Implement a manage endpoint encryption solution utilizing TrendMicro MobileArmor to secure university workstations against sensitive data loss.
  • Review system security plans, risk assessments, and compliance with NIST minimal security controls.
  • Assess network against NIST SP 800-53 rev3 security controls.
  • Review of PowerBroker root user logs on SOX UNIX systems.
  • Automate regression scenarios and update existing regression suite (QTP).
